What Is Cystatin C

Cystatin C is a small protein produced by nearly all cells in the body. It is released into the bloodstream at a consistent rate and removed almost entirely by the kidneys. Because of this process, the level of cystatin C in the blood closely reflects how efficiently the kidneys are filtering waste.

When kidney filtration slows, cystatin C levels rise. This direct relationship makes it a reliable indicator of kidney function and an important complement to traditional GFR lab tests.

How Cystatin C Relates to GFR and eGFR Meaning

The glomerular filtration rate measures how well the kidneys filter blood. Many lab reports show an estimated value called eGFR, which helps assess kidney performance.

Traditional eGFR calculations rely on creatinine. However, creatinine levels can be affected by muscle mass, diet, age, and physical activity. This can sometimes lead to confusion, especially in athletes or older adults.

Cystatin C helps improve accuracy by offering an alternative way to estimate kidney filtration. When used alongside creatinine, it provides a clearer picture of true kidney function.

Why Cystatin C Is an Important Health Marker

Many people first encounter kidney testing when experiencing kidney disease symptoms, such as fatigue, swelling, or changes in urination. However, kidney problems often develop long before symptoms appear.

Cystatin C is valuable because it:

  • Detects early changes in kidney filtration

  • Helps clarify borderline eGFR results

  • Supports accurate staging of chronic kidney disease

  • Provides insight across different body types

This makes it particularly useful in identifying early chronic kidney disease stages.

Understanding Chronic Kidney Disease Stages

Chronic kidney disease is commonly divided into stages based on GFR values.

  • Stage 3 kidney disease indicates moderate reduction in kidney function

  • Stage 4 kidney disease reflects more advanced decline

  • Stage 5 kidney disease represents kidney failure stages

Accurate assessment is critical, especially for people managing conditions like diabetes and kidney disease, where kidney damage can progress silently.

Cystatin C helps support more precise evaluation within these stages.

How This Differs From Traditional Kidney Markers

Traditional kidney markers can vary widely between individuals with similar kidney function. This variation can make interpretation difficult.

Cystatin C is different because:

  • It is not strongly influenced by muscle mass

  • It remains more stable across different body types

  • It detects early kidney changes more effectively

  • It provides clearer results in older adults

These characteristics make it a trusted marker in many health assessments, including monitoring progression toward kidney failure stages.

Who Benefits Most From Understanding It

Physically Active Individuals and Athletes

High muscle mass can affect creatinine based results. Cystatin C provides clearer insight that is not distorted by physical build.

People With Diabetes

Diabetes and kidney disease are closely linked. Early kidney monitoring helps slow progression.

Older Adults

Age related changes can influence traditional markers. Cystatin C offers more consistent information.

People Reviewing Borderline Results

When GFR lab test results fall near thresholds such as stage 3 kidney disease, cystatin C can help provide clarity.

Can You Improve GFR of the Kidney

While GFR naturally declines with age, certain steps may help support kidney health:

  • Managing blood sugar in diabetes

  • Controlling blood pressure

  • Staying hydrated

  • Avoiding unnecessary strain on the kidneys

  • Monitoring kidney markers regularly

Blood testing helps track whether these efforts are supporting kidney function over time.
